How to Make Basil Salt An Easy DIY Gourmet Finishing Salt The Rising

Instructions. Pre heat oven to 225 degrees. Pulse the kosher salt and the basil together in a chopper or food processor ( I only have a mini chopper and it worked just fine). Spread on a baking sheet and bake until dry, 30-40 minutes. Once cools down, pulse again to make a fine powder. Wha-la!

Basil Salt Frugal Upstate

Preheat the oven to 225-degrees F. Add the kosher salt and basil to your food processor. Pulse the mixture until the basil is very fine. Spread the mixture onto a baking sheet lined with parchment paper in an even layer. Bake for 15 minutes, then toss the mixture. Return to the oven and bake for another 20 minutes.
